What to Look For

When searching for an electrician, there are several key factors to consider. First and foremost, ensure they are licensed by the Florida Department of Business and Professional Regulation (DBPR). A valid license is a must-have to guarantee the electrician has the necessary training and expertise. Additionally, look for proof of insurance, which will protect you in case of accidents or property damage.

However, not all licensed electricians are created equal. Be wary of red flags, such as unprofessional communication, low bids that seem too good to be true, or contractors who are unwilling to provide references or proof of their experience.

What It Costs

The cost of hiring an electrician in Palm Beach County can vary widely, depending on the scope of the project and the electrician's level of experience. Here are some rough estimates for common electrical services:

  • Basic electrical repairs (e.g., fixing a flickering light): $100-$300
  • Upgrading to a new lighting system: $500-$1,500
  • Installing a new electrical panel: $1,000-$3,000
  • Running new electrical lines or wiring: $2,000-$5,000

Keep in mind that these are general estimates, and the actual cost may vary depending on the electrician and the specific requirements of your project.

Tips to Get the Best Results

As a homeowner in South Florida, you're likely no stranger to the sun and heat. Here are a few tips to help you hire the right electrician for your needs:

  • Schedule work during the cooler months: Summer storms can be intense, and scheduling work during the cooler months (December to February) can help minimize disruptions and ensure a smoother installation process.
  • Ask about energy-efficient upgrades: If you're planning to upgrade your electrical system, ask about energy-efficient options, such as LED lighting or solar panels, which can help reduce your energy bills and contribute to a more sustainable lifestyle.
  • Look for electricians with a focus on customer service: A good electrician should prioritize customer satisfaction, providing clear explanations of the work to be done, answering your questions, and ensuring the job is completed to your satisfaction.
  • Check online reviews: Look for electricians with excellent online reviews, which can give you an idea of their reputation and level of customer satisfaction.
